There are heaps of ways to tune in to what’s hot and happening in the LGBTQ world – if you take advantage of Twitter! If you are already a Twitter tweeter, or want to scan for LGBTQ news from a variety of sources, or are interested in finding good LGBTQ Tweets to follow, just enter #LGBT (hashtag LGBT)! If you add more letters (LGBTQ, LGBQI) you will get different results, all very timely and interesting! Whatever hashtag you prefer, you will you will pick up tweets from the most active LGBT groups – GLAAD, The Advocate, Freedom to Marry, It Gets Better, and many more. In addition, if any mainstream group is doing something important for our communities, you will find it here quickly and easily! This morning, the U.S. Department of State is coming up near the top of the list with news of the first UN Security Council on LGBT rights!
If you are interested in following any of your favorite LGBTQ advocacy groups, once you see their tweets from your hashtag search, you will see their twitter identity, and can easily follow those you find most interesting!
